How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Windsor?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Windsor Studio Apartments | C$1,057 | C$399 | C$1,580 |
Windsor 1 Bedroom Apartments | C$1,844 | C$450 | C$2,568 |
Windsor 2 Bedroom Apartments | C$2,153 | C$1,250 | C$2,982 |
Windsor 3 Bedroom Apartments | C$1,913 | C$1,699 | C$2,299 |
Windsor 4 Bedroom Apartments | C$4,840 | C$1,500 | C$8,180 |
